Building a Strong Case for Primary Custody

Building a strong case for primary custody begins with gathering comprehensive and compelling evidence that demonstrates your ability to provide a stable and nurturing environment for the children. This involves showcasing your capacity as a parent through detailed documentation, such as employment records, references from teachers and healthcare providers, and any history of successfully raising other children or acting as a primary caregiver. It’s crucial to present a unified front with your co-parent, if applicable, by agreeing on key parenting principles and decision-making processes that prioritize the best interests of the children.

Presenting Your Case Effectively in Court

When presenting your case for primary custody in court, it’s crucial to have strong, compelling evidence to support your claim. This includes gathering documentation such as financial statements, employment records, and educational achievements, which can demonstrate your ability to provide a stable and nurturing environment for the children. A well-prepared and organized presentation can significantly influence the judge’s decision.
